Thrombey Estate House

Ransom Drysdale targets the Thrombey Estate house, the family's sprawling residence and epicenter of Harlan Thrombey's death investigation. He arrives at the front drive, ignores Lieutenant Elliott's questions, corrects his name with a classist quip, dismisses the officers and Trooper Wagner with 'Uh huh,' brushes past them, kicks the estate dogs aside, and forces entry without invitation, treating the building as his personal domain amid police presence.
